YouTube has become a huge platform where millions of users share opinions, ask questions, and engage in conversations daily. For businesses, content creators, and researchers, YouTube comments can be a treasure trove of insights. From gauging audience sentiment to understanding user behavior, scraping YouTube comments can provide valuable data for decision-making.
In this blog post, we will go through how to scrape YouTube comments effectively and ethically to unlock instant insights.
Why Scrape YouTube Comments?
Scraping YouTube comments can help you:
Understand Audience Sentiment: Discover how viewers perceive your content or a specific topic.
Identify Trends: Find repetitive topics, issues, or suggestions from the comments.
Enhance Content Creation: Use feedback to create better and more targeted content.
Competitor Analysis: Analyze comments on competitors’ videos to gain an edge.
Research and Development: Collect data for academic, market, or product research.
Tools for Scraping YouTube Comments
Several tools can help you scrape YouTube comments without requiring extensive coding knowledge. Here are a few popular ones:
1. ScrapeLead
A powerful, user-friendly tool that simplifies scraping YouTube comments.
No coding is required, making it ideal for beginners.
Visit ScrapeLead to get started.
2. YouTube API
Google’s official API allows you to retrieve comments programmatically.
Requires setting up an API key and some basic coding knowledge.
3. Third-Party Scraping Tools
Tools like Octoparse and ParseHub can scrape comments with a graphical interface.
Best suited for those who prefer visual workflows.
Step-by-Step Guide to Scraping YouTube Comments
Follow these steps to scrape YouTube comments efficiently:
Step 1: Identify the Video
Choose the YouTube video whose comments you want to scrape. Copy its URL.
Step 2: Choose a Tool
Select a scraping tool that fits your needs and technical expertise.
Step 3: Configure the Tool
For example, using the YouTube API:
Sign up for a Google Cloud account.
Create a project and enable the YouTube Data API.
Use a script to extract comments based on the video ID.
Step 4: Extract the Data
Run the tool or script to fetch comments. Ensure you capture useful metadata such as:
Comment text
Author’s name
Number of likes
Timestamp
Step 5: Analyze the Data
Analyze the data using tools like Excel, Google Sheets, or Python libraries, such as pandas and nltk, to look for patterns, sentiments, and trends.
Best Practices for Ethical Scraping
Respect YouTube’s Terms of Service: Your scrapes must not go against YouTube's policy.
Avoid Overloading Servers: Use rate limits to prevent sending excessive requests.
Safeguard user privacy: Never misuse or publicly share sensitive user information.
Provide Value: Use the scraped data to provide meaningful insights instead of spamming or exploiting users.
Real-Life Use Cases
Content Optimization: A YouTuber analyses comments to find topics of interest for future videos.
Brand Monitoring: A company monitors comments on product-related videos to determine customer opinions.
Market Research: Comment pickers come to gather comments from the public about some trending issue.
Conclusion
Scraping YouTube comments can also be incredibly useful for providing instant insights into a variety of applications. Whether you are a content creator, a marketer, or a researcher, data in YouTube comments will help you make informed decisions and stay ahead of the competition.
Get ready to start now! Check out ScrapeLead for a no-code solution to scrape YouTube comments efficiently today!
Know More \>> https://scrapelead.io/blog/how-to-scrape-youtube-comments-for-instant-insights/